The Punjab University has clarified that its students do not need to pay parking or toll entry charges. The exemption applies at the university’s entry points.
The clarification was issued by the Directorate of Student Affairs (DSA). The directorate shared the information through its official social media account.
The DSA said the university had already issued several notifications about the exemption. Students were therefore advised to follow the required identification process when entering the campus.
Students must identify themselves as university students at the entry points. They must also present a valid Student Identification Card to the relevant staff.
The university explained that toll collectors cannot always determine who qualifies for the exemption. Proper identification is therefore necessary for students seeking free entry.
The Punjab University has advised students to avoid arguments with contractors or toll collectors. Students should simply show their valid Student Identification Cards when requested.
The DSA also asked students to report any violation of the policy. Students can report cases where they are charged despite showing proper identification.
Complaints can be sent to the DSA through its official email address. Students can also contact the Security Control Room through WhatsApp.
The DSA provided a WhatsApp contact number for reporting such incidents. Students should share relevant information when submitting a complaint.
Providing complete details can help authorities verify the incident. The university can then determine whether a contractor or toll collector violated the instructions.
The DSA warned that violations could result in action against contractors. If a contractor is found charging an identified student, a heavy fine may follow.
The fine would be imposed by the Office of Resident Officer-I. This measure is intended to ensure compliance with the university’s exemption policy.
